😉 Tariffs Rattle Markets

Copper prices surged by over 5% in New York as U.S. President Trump indicated a potential 25% tariff on imports, sparking a frantic rally in Comex copper trading.

His remarks, made during a congressional address, fuelled speculation that tariffs could be imposed sooner and at a higher rate than previously anticipated. This comes after a Commerce Department investigation into whether tariffs on copper are necessary for national security reasons.

The price surge has widened the gap between Comex and London Metal Exchange (LME) copper, with Comex now trading at nearly a 12% premium. This discrepancy has ignited a global rush to secure copper shipments before enforcing tariffs.

LME copper also rose by 2.5%, while zinc and aluminium gained 2.5% and 1.7%, respectively, as industrial metals and mining stocks rallied amid broader economic and geopolitical shifts.

👏 Critical Minerals and More

NioCorp Developments Ltd. NASDAQ: NB ( ▼ 3.57% ) highlights President Trump’s announcement of “historic action” to expand U.S. critical minerals and rare earths production.

The move is expected to accelerate projects like NioCorp’s fully permitted Elk Creek Critical Minerals Project in Nebraska, which aims to produce niobium, scandium, titanium, and rare earth elements.

Key proposals to support U.S. mining include low-interest loans for permitted projects, streamlined permitting, and expanded Department of Defense funding.

NioCorp executives advocate for policies to reduce U.S. reliance on China and BRICS nations, positioning the U.S. as a leader in critical minerals production.
